Moore, James Tice was born on August 8, 1945 in Greenville, South Carolina, United States. Son of William Furman and Aileen Sylvester (Pinion) Moore.
Bachelor in History, University of Southern California, 1966; Master of Arts in History, University of Virginia, 1968; Doctor of Philosophy in History, University of Virginia, 1972.
Instructor history, Virginia Commonwealth U., Richmond, 1970-1972;
assistant professor of history, Virginia Commonwealth U., Richmond, 1972-1978;
associate professor of history, Virginia Commonwealth U., Richmond, 1978-1984;
acting department chairman history, Virginia Commonwealth U., Richmond, 1981-1982;
department chairman history, Virginia Commonwealth U., Richmond, 1982-1986;
professor of history, Virginia Commonwealth U., Richmond, since 1984. Member editorial advisory board Journal Southern History, Houston, 1982-1985, Va.Mag. History & Biography, Richmond, 1988-1991.
Board directors University Press of Virginia, Charlottesville, 1986-1989.
Appointed member Patrick Henry Memorial State Commission, Richmond, 1985-1987. Member Raven Society University of Virginia, Phi Beta Kappa, Phi Kappa Phi.
Married Jessie Louise Roberts, 1965. Children: Leslie Anne, Evan Christopher, Sharon Elizabeth.
